MANILA, Philippines – The 2015 UAAP Cheerdance is finally over and as with every year, the social media eruption is always a joy to watch or participate in.

The NU Pep Squad clinched a third consecutive title after besting first runner-up UST Salinggawi Dance Troupe and surprise second-runner up UP Pep Squad.

Many netizens did not expect National University to retain the title after a several errors during their performance, including one where they failed to complete a pyramid.

NU registered a total of 668 points – 91.5 on tumbling, 70.5 on stunts, 84 on tosses, 88 on pyramids, and 340 on dance.

UST had 651.5 points, while UP garnered 610.5 points.


While some netizens were not satisfied and questioned the results, others were also happy for NU and offered their congratulations to the team that still impressed with stunts of a high level of difficulty.
